Undergraduate Academic Advisor 2 (Marion)
Marion | Academic Advising and Career Services
Provides comprehensive academic advising to undergraduate students on the Ohio State Marion campus to support success, progression, and career development related to select undergraduate degrees. Guides goal setting, academic planning, and course selection; Interprets university and campus policies and degree requirements; and monitors academic progress.
Advises students pursuing a variety of majors, facilitates referrals to campus resources, and supports academic transitions. Contributes to instruction of survey course, participates in orientation programs, and engages in workgroups, student organizations, and recruitment efforts. Effectively communicates and collaborates with colleagues and departments on the Marion campus and across the university. Occasional evening and weekend responsibilities required.

Responsibilities and Duties:
Provides and documents comprehensive one-on-one academic advising to undergraduate students on degree and program options, academic standards, general education, prerequisite and major requirements and course selection. Support students experiencing academic, probationary, and financial concerns, and connects them to appropriate academic, career, financial, and wellness resources. Reviews and processes student requests, including but not limited to add/drop course requests, withdraws, and program changes, ensuring alignment with university policies and timelines. Identifies complex or unresolved issues and consults with or escalates to senior staff as appropriate.
Assist with instruction of the student survey course by enhancing and delivering established curriculum while incorporating responsive and dynamic instructional practices to engage students and enhance learning. Adapts facilitation techniques as needed to support diverse learners, reinforce key concepts, and encourage participation. Participates in required training, maintains familiarity with course material and learning objectives, and evaluates and grades student assignments in alignment with course standards and expectations.
Assist with and participates in student orientation programs by preparing materials and presenting orientation content. Conducts one-on-one advising appointments for new first year and transfer students to support initial academic planning, course enrollment, and successful transition to the university.
Under regular direction, participates and supports special advising related projects as assigned while proactively identifying and recommending new project opportunities to leadership. Performs administrative tasks support advising and student affairs functions, as guided by the director, including other duties as assigned. Actively engages in ongoing professional development and participates in campus and university level initiatives and opportunities.
